The product exchange data technology is an important base for a heterogeneous collaborative design. A new feature-based CAD data exchange technology is presented, which is based on mapping of modeling function set. This approach ensures efficient data exchange among heterogeneous CAD systems, and high-level design intent of designer is reserved. This paper put forwards a collaborative design system which based on the feature-based CAD data exchange. Some key technologies, modeling sharing, collaborative design agent are researched. Lastly,, collaborative design-implementing is proposed.